jfines69
12-07-2017, 03:30 AM
The die dot does look spot on just a little larger... The E and R on Wexlers did take a hit and that most likely is throwing me off there... The pre-crack depression on Wexlers sample looks incuse on the coin which relates to in relief on the die... If it were a pre-crack or a chip I would expect the die to be incuse and in relief on the coin??? I do not know enough about the pre-crack depression theory to make things click... On a pre-crack depression does the shape change as it progresses into a crack??? Your images are good with the 2nd set being better... Jon has let me take an in hand look at this coin and get some pics... Thank you Jon... I really appreciate it... Now for what I have found - This coin does not appear to be WDDO-006 http://doubleddie.com/2318537.html The fore head crack on Jons coin is much farther east than the sample on Wexlers... Also the die dot between the D and W on Jons is to far north... I also have done a little research on the top horizontal bar of the E in LIBERTY and I believe it is a part of the DDO... I have looked back thru Wexlers listings of the shield DDOs and have found several that exhibit the same distortion and appear to be highly similar in the direction of the doubling - Here is the list -
